(1) A sum due to the Committee shall be paid at its office during hours as may be fixed by the Market Committee and shall be received by a person appointed for the purpose who shall sign and issue receipts thereof:
'Provided that receipts for amount exceeding Rupees One Hundred shall be countersigned by the Secretary or another employee authorised by him not lower in rank to that of Mandi Supervisor-cum-Fee Collector:
Provided further that the counter signature shall not be necessary in cases where the amount is received through Account Payee Cheques:
(2) An employee of the Committee appointed to receive or handle money on behalf of the Committee shall, before entering on his duties, furnish a cash security of Rs. 500 or personal security equal to four times the amount which he is expected to handle within a week. The Chairman shall be the final authority to determine the amount which a servant is expected to handle within a week, on behalf of the Committee :
Provided that this clause shall not apply to a person who has been appointed in stop gap arrangement from within the office.
